Comprehending Mental Health Assessment
A mental health assessment is an organized approach utilized by mental health specialists to evaluate an individual's emotional, psychological, and social wellness. The primary goals of these assessments are to:
Identify mental health concerns.Figure out the intensity of the issues.Establish an appropriate treatment strategy.Monitor progress gradually.Secret Components of Mental Health Assessment
The mental health assessment process typically involves a number of key parts:
Clinical Interview: A structured or semi-structured discussion in between the clinician and the private to check out symptoms, history, and individual background.Psychological Testing: Objective tests, such as questionnaires or standardized assessments, to evaluate specific locations of mental health.Observation: Clinicians thoroughly observe the person's behavior, psychological responses, and interactions.Collaboration: Involving member of the family or substantial others can provide extra insights into the individual's behavior and mental state.
The assessment process is comprehensive and tailored to the individual's unique needs, ensuring that professionals gather sufficient information for accurate diagnoses and efficient interventions.
The Impact of Mental Health AssessmentsBenefits of Conducting Mental Health Assessments
Early Diagnosis: One of the most significant benefits of mental health assessments is the capability to identify issues early. Early diagnosis can result in timely intervention, enhancing recovery rates and lessening long-lasting complications.

Informed Treatment Plans: Accurate assessments provide experts with a clear photo of the person's mental health, allowing them to craft personalized treatment plans. Reliable treatment can include therapy, medication, or a combination of both, customized to the individual's particular requirements.

By normalizing discussions about mental health, assessments can encourage people to seek help without worry of judgment.

Research and Policy Development: Aggregate information from assessments play a critical role in mental health research and the solution of policies. It helps in identifying trends, notifying public health methods, and advocating for improved mental health resources.

Long-Term Monitoring: Mental health assessments are not a one-time process. They are essential for tracking development with time, assisting in essential adjustments in treatment plans, and guaranteeing ongoing support.
Possible Challenges in Mental Health Assessments
While mental health assessments carry various benefits, they are not without challenges. Some of these include:

Subjectivity: Responses during interviews and questionnaires can be subjective, influenced by various elements including the person's state of mind, understanding, and desire to share.

Resource Limitations: Availability of qualified experts and mental health resources can pose barriers, particularly in underserved neighborhoods.

Cultural Sensitivity: Mental health assessments need to think about cultural distinctions and beliefs. Misinterpreting cultural contexts can result in inaccurate assessments.
The Role of Technology in Mental Health Assessments
The rise of telehealth and digital tools has actually had a profound impact on mental health assessments. Technology boosts ease of access and effectiveness through:

Mental health assessments are carried out by various specialists, including psychologists, psychiatrists, certified therapists, and social employees. Each professional may utilize different assessment approaches based upon their training and knowledge.
How frequently should mental health assessments be carried out?
The frequency of mental health assessments mostly depends upon private requirements. Generally, people going through treatment may be examined routinely to keep an eye on progress, while those without any prior issues might take advantage of periodic examinations, especially during considerable life events.
Are mental health assessments covered by insurance coverage?
Coverage for mental health assessments differs by insurance coverage company and policy. It is a good idea for people to consult their insurance business regarding protection details and to communicate with their doctor about costs.
Can mental health assessments recognize all mental health conditions?
While mental health assessments are designed to gather comprehensive details, they might not constantly identify every condition. Complex or co-occurring disorders might need more substantial evaluation and observation.
What can people do to get ready for a mental health assessment?
Preparation for a mental health assessment can consist of:
Reflecting on symptoms experienced for greater clarity throughout conversations.Gathering appropriate case history and any previous mental health evaluations.Being open and honest in communication with the assessor.
